Analysis

Moldova recorded 11.2% for share of electricity generation from low-carbon sources in 2025. That is the highest value across all 26 years on record.

That represents a change of up 4.6% on the previous year and up 150.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, share of electricity generation from low-carbon sources in Moldova peaked at 11.2% in 2025 and was at its lowest, 4.1%, in 2016.

Moldova ranks 160th of 213 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 26 years of available data.

Measured as a percentage of total electricity produced in the country or region. Low-carbon sources correspond to renewables and nuclear power, that produce significantly less greenhouse-gas emissions than fossil fuels. Renewables include solar, wind, hydropower, bioenergy, geothermal, wave, and tidal.
